HP SIM on ESX Hosts

A while back I installed HP Sim on our hosts that at the time were not in production. Since then they have been put in to production and I now have a new SIM server. Which has a different name and IP. Is there a way to change that configuration on the hosts without taking them down? Thanks

Hello. As best I remember, you can use http://esxhostname:2381 and configure the snmp settings from there without any downtime.
